1. Understanding Key Programming

Key programming is the procedure of setting up a vehicle’s key or key fob to interact with the car’s immobilizer system. Modern automobiles frequently have advanced security functions that employ innovative innovation to prevent theft. This security is mostly dependent on the programming of keys and key fobs.

1.1 Types of Automotive Keys

There are a number of types of keys utilized in modern-day vehicles. Comprehending these types is essential for both customers and automotive professionals:

  • Traditional Mechanical Keys: These keys are manually cut to fit the vehicle’s ignition lock. They do not contain electronic parts.

  • Transponder Keys: These keys consist of a chip that communicates with the vehicle’s onboard computer. When the key is placed, the car validates the signal before permitting the engine to begin.

  • Remote Keyless Entry (RKE) Keys: Often described as “key fobs,” these devices enable the user to unlock and start the vehicle without placing a physical key into the ignition.

  • Smart Keys: These advanced keys permit keyless entry and ignition. The vehicle spots the presence of the wise key, making it possible for the motorist to begin the engine with the push of a button.

1.2 The Importance of Key Programming

Key programming plays a pivotal role in automotive security and performance. Here are some reasons why it is considerable:

  1. Anti-theft Protection: Properly programmed keys avoid unapproved access to the vehicle, decreasing the risk of theft.

  2. Compatibility: Key programming guarantees that the key or fob is compatible with the specific make and model of the vehicle, allowing it to function correctly.

  3. Functionality Restoration: If a key is lost or damaged, programming a brand-new key or reprogramming an existing one brings back the vehicle’s functionality.

2. The Key Programming Process

The key programming procedure can differ depending upon the kind of key, vehicle make and design, and manufacturer. However, it normally includes a number of key actions:

2.1 Preparing the Vehicle

Before beginning the programming procedure, it is vital to:

  • Ensure the vehicle is in a location devoid of blockages.
  • Have all essential keys present for programming (if relevant).
  • Detach any previous keys or fobs from the vehicle’s memory.

2.2 Programming Steps

While the specific procedure may vary, the following steps offer a general standard for key programming:

  1. Accessing the Vehicle’s ECU: Connect a programming tool or key programmer to the vehicle’s On-Board Diagnostics (OBD-II) port.

  2. Picking the Programming Feature: Use the programming tool to locate and choose the key programming function in the vehicle’s ECU.

  3. Entering Key Information: Input the pertinent key details as triggered by the programming tool.

  4. Verifying Programming: Follow the programming tool’s directions to confirm if the key has been successfully programmed.

  5. Checking the Key: After programming, test the key or fob to ensure it runs all needed functionalities, consisting of locking/unlocking doors and beginning the engine.

2.3 Common Tools Used

Mechanics and automotive specialists typically rely on specialized tools to facilitate key programming:

  • OBD-II Key Programmers: Devices that connect to the vehicle’s OBD-II port to program keys directly through the ECU.

  • Committed Key Programming Devices: Standalone units created specifically for key programming across numerous vehicle makes and models.

  • Manufacturer-Specific Diagnostic Tools: Tools developed by vehicle producers that offer innovative programming capabilities.

3. Regularly Asked Questions (FAQs)

3.1 How long does it take to program a key?

The time required to program a key can vary commonly. Basic programming jobs can often be finished in 5-10 minutes, while more intricate procedures might take up to an hour.

3.2 Can I program a key myself?

Sometimes, vehicle owners can program their keys using directions from user handbooks or online resources. Nevertheless, certain designs may need an expert service technician.

3.3 What should I do if I lose all my keys?

If all keys are lost, a qualified locksmith or dealership may require to reprogram the vehicle’s ECU and offer new keys. This procedure can be more pricey and time-consuming than programming extra keys.

3.4 Is it necessary to reprogram a key after a battery change in my key fob?

Most of the times, changing the battery in a key fob does not need reprogramming. Nevertheless, if the fob stops working to work after a battery modification, it may require to be reprogrammed.
